Best breweries in Dijon, France

Within 16 miles of Dijon we track 13 breweries. 2 rate Great. La Maison Romane in Nuits-Saint-Georges leads the list at 4.28 (Great).

Ranked breweries

  1. 1

    La Maison Romane

    Nuits-Saint-Georges, Bourgogne-Franche-Comté, France

    FR/ La brasserie est spécialisée en bières de fermentation haute en levures indigènes. Fermentations de raisins, autres fruits de terroirs et plantes sauvages de Bourgogne. Longs élevages en foudres. Également producteur de cidres et de vins naturels. EN/ The brewery specializes in highly fermented beers with indigenous yeasts. Fermentations of grapes, other local fruits, and wild plants from Burgundy. Long ageing in vats. Also a producer of ciders and natural wines.

    Rating
    4.28Great
